Description
A young man is condemned to death for breaking a law that forbids sex outside marriage. When his sister pleads with Lord Angelo to save him, he offers her a bargain: her brother’s life in exchange for her virginity. One of Shakespeare’s most enigmatic plays, Measure for Measure is a morally complex drama of intricate moves and countermoves that explores falsehood, justice, and humanity’s best and basest instincts. The edition includes an introduction by Julia Briggs and a quotation from A. S. Byatt on Shakespeare’s use of language.
